IO Interactive Takes to Twitter to Update Fans on Studio Changes

May 23, 2017 by Jordan Biazzo

We hope IO Interactive lands on new gig soon!

Earlier this month we heard the sad news of Square Enix and IO Interactive parting ways, as the Japanese publisher plans to focus more energy on key franchises and studios.

After some radio silence from both ends, today IO Interactive took to Twitter to update fans on their plans. Stating in the Twitter post “We’re sad that great talent and good friends will be leaving the studio.”

Square Enix has not made it extremely clear why they cut IO Interactive, but they did state the following:

“To maximize player satisfaction as well as market potential going forward, we are focusing our resources and energies on key franchises and studios. As a result, the Company has regrettably decided to withdraw from the business of Io Interactive, a wholly‐owned subsidiary and a Danish corporation, as of March 31, 2017.”

Seeing layoffs and developers getting cut is never a good time especially when they create such great content. In fact, ever since the launch of Hitman season one, many gamers were starting to get more into the franchise. It will be sad to see some of those devs leave IO, but we hope they find a new place to work on games soon.
